             Lab publication in @ExpPhysiol...this was a fun study! A combined effort from Dr. @MErinMoir and Dr. Adam Corkery @uwmadkines
          
          
            
            physoc.onlinelibrary.wiley.com
              This research examined the impact of aerobic exercise intensity and dose on acute post-exercise cerebral shear stress and blood flow. Fourteen young adults (27 ± 5 years of age, eight females)...
